From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TP id 038F545987 for ; Tue, 28 Feb 2023 12:25:15 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 9340B68A904; Tue, 28 Feb 2023 14:25:12 +0200 (EET) Received: from out162-62-57-49.mail.qq.com (out162-62-57-49.mail.qq.com [162.62.57.49]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id 75E836809C7 for ; Tue, 28 Feb 2023 14:25:04 +0200 (EET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=foxmail.com; s=s201512; t=1677587101; bh=ifkWAWLJx4i1gms1nX2BUMcHXrBM/tIcPXTcEySKRkU=; h=From:Subject:Date:References:To:In-Reply-To; b=ner4a4dbRcD+FYgF6fJNSpKCZODmLv8C9QMNIvK948i/lCFdK/lKGSROv5fSTGeYD poOl/+hmQreatTfw3LA4im0sQYEcCUN1Xa+BL07tSjUyGbozrWNEEbZg2XH4egqusc CxQZ+lWT9TnLt3cHQMkqP5FtHkFCV5CI0s0u8Dc4= Received: from smtpclient.apple ([113.108.77.56]) by newxmesmtplogicsvrsza12-0.qq.com (NewEsmtp) with SMTP id 6401F25E; Tue, 28 Feb 2023 20:25:00 +0800 X-QQ-mid: xmsmtpt1677587100t28hcjvge Message-ID: X-QQ-XMAILINFO: MyIXMys/8kCtDHjsKAbVXJOVE6zm0mKHEs5CgX5wXZ16eQJ48+44ZPRukdmfxm mPboUeKAvLcHFbHG7LCVxpkul0P+3eIWEZsv3uM4Jo9K3I9CevnGytjyGqUexiZuwEJ7NLg14kWi BJzk31PfM3wXSgLvTArxL7YXW6x2tZLyOagZEoP4Yj378vAiX69DCUfELyEJe1S6nrFThWw6M0vG +qmAVUwLF0EHkiBfHchGjBwTCDAJ8Za+pJU6bNHacF94BQBaucm1OEdz51oSpsnhaZi8i+sAGsY9 xB9eaerOUOf4IvTtYMl2p30XUfF7qJvvrRkrjxutFsHld0bQ1pBWNSYTI7qfr0yyanSLN/bh/cf+ Wr6MfmfNAuZsCPdzmkBtGgsyrblF+1/Dr8aLC9l0U9u5OVVJGeHPAvgLk9Q9D5lfEuuDZL9eKRNx XhShOi/tudjxa9otc+SoFxawELh/Ul+JBZhLl+mol2yor5PsXlywV08jBehyS/NBqJNolq0eO6Nc Jdaj0ikxRpFQ3xePTmJJLZRk/Q8rsdbveLaZiK2JeD2w0I2h+QUImu66+9lzXDPPMvQiOPBCIedB 622G/iQVPBz0/iy4rEWpdgDHnil4vZiEFAIVzGGXrgWqSY8ggFJ4zWQspEGcjs3BeFZs7FJy/i0L D3sqIhHzWalDLaj8dC572bH7GxD/K6I9oL2x6XPv8pwJqLEPJVc70KfN9dDNN3DH4rXXPTmCeFON nqDKinlH4k59sPctfypLD1kJpY6FQOZEmXpkpv7IrXZpRiVBXEXj3a0f77/Pl+5PhL7IQXz5iAk6 13GEb2QzTyWMrjaKcse1CGLDkv+MkqhL3tzYZdHZ54Cru1xHOKdXHOyb3SCpuBicaYVniBuduyTK eS+RS9Tc4Fz15HgEBJiZb9r7PJx2zpO1FBYxld48plzSYhPi+p8vlNu7XwHlMCZ/dPcE3gx3mvUx mUKiWnh9BjEEbv8xQpW7voAdAJY/Ld From: =?utf-8?B?InpoaWxpemhhbyjotbXlv5fnq4spIg==?= Mime-Version: 1.0 (Mac OS X Mail 16.0 \(3696.120.41.1.1\)) Date: Tue, 28 Feb 2023 20:25:01 +0800 References: <015df2df4818b87922ab0e358d1949d50698a71b.camel@haerdin.se> To: FFmpeg development discussions and patches In-Reply-To: <015df2df4818b87922ab0e358d1949d50698a71b.camel@haerdin.se> X-OQ-MSGID: X-Mailer: Apple Mail (2.3696.120.41.1.1) Subject: Re: [FFmpeg-devel] [PATCH 4/4] lavc/mediacodecenc: List supported pixel formats on configuration error X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: PiBUaGlzIHBhdGNoIGhhcyBiZWVuIHJlbGVhc2VkIGJ5IEVwaWMgR2FtZXMnIGxlZ2FsIGRlcGFy dG1lbnQuCj4gLS0tCj4gIGxpYmF2Y29kZWMvbWVkaWFjb2RlY2VuYy5jIHwgNDYgKysrKysrKysr KysrKysrKysrKysrKysrKysrKysrKysrKysrKysKPiAgMSBmaWxlIGNoYW5nZWQsIDQ2IGluc2Vy dGlvbnMoKykKPiAKPiBkaWZmIC0tZ2l0IGEvbGliYXZjb2RlYy9tZWRpYWNvZGVjZW5jLmMgYi9s aWJhdmNvZGVjL21lZGlhY29kZWNlbmMuYwo+IGluZGV4IDAzYzgwY2JmOTkuLjFiOGEyODM3YzQg MTAwNjQ0Cj4gLS0tIGEvbGliYXZjb2RlYy9tZWRpYWNvZGVjZW5jLmMKPiArKysgYi9saWJhdmNv ZGVjL21lZGlhY29kZWNlbmMuYwo+IEBAIC05Nyw2ICs5NywxMiBAQCBzdGF0aWMgY29uc3QgZW51 bSBBVlBpeGVsRm9ybWF0IGF2Y19waXhfZm10c1tdID0gewo+ICAgICAgQVZfUElYX0ZNVF9OT05F Cj4gIH07Cj4gIAo+ICtzdGF0aWMgY29uc3QgaW50IGluX2Zvcm1hdHNbXSA9IHsKPiArICAgIENP TE9SX0Zvcm1hdFlVVjQyMFBsYW5hciwKPiArICAgIENPTE9SX0Zvcm1hdFlVVjQyMFNlbWlQbGFu YXIsCj4gKyAgICBDT0xPUl9Gb3JtYXRTdXJmYWNlLAo+ICt9Owo+ICsKPiAgc3RhdGljIHZvaWQg bWVkaWFjb2RlY19vdXRwdXRfZm9ybWF0KEFWQ29kZWNDb250ZXh0ICphdmN0eCkKPiAgewo+ICAg ICAgTWVkaWFDb2RlY0VuY0NvbnRleHQgKnMgPSBhdmN0eC0+cHJpdl9kYXRhOwo+IEBAIC0xMzEs NiArMTM3LDQ1IEBAIHN0YXRpYyBlbnVtIEFWUGl4ZWxGb3JtYXQgY29sb3IycGl4X2ZtdChBVkNv ZGVjQ29udGV4dCAqYXZjdHgsIGludCBjb2xvcl9mb3JtYXQpCj4gICAgICBhdl9hc3NlcnQwKDAp Owo+ICB9Cj4gIAo+ICsvLyBsaXN0IHBpeGVsIGZvcm1hdHMgaWYgdGhlIHVzZXIgdHJpZWQgdG8g dXNlIG9uZSB0aGF0IGlzbid0IHN1cHBvcnRlZCBvbiB0aGlzIGRldmljZQo+ICtzdGF0aWMgdm9p ZCBsaXN0X3BpeF9mbXRzKEFWQ29kZWNDb250ZXh0ICphdmN0eCwgY29uc3QgY2hhciAqbWltZSkK PiArewo+ICsgICAgTWVkaWFDb2RlY0VuY0NvbnRleHQgKnMgPSBhdmN0eC0+cHJpdl9kYXRhOwo+ ICsgICAgaW50IG91dF9mb3JtYXRzW0ZGX0FSUkFZX0VMRU1TKGluX2Zvcm1hdHMpXSwgbjsKPiAr ICAgIGNoYXIgKm5hbWUgPSBmZl9BTWVkaWFDb2RlY19nZXROYW1lKHMtPmNvZGVjKTsKPiArCj4g KyAgICBpZiAoIW5hbWUpIHsKPiArICAgICAgICAvLyBBUEkgbGV2ZWwgbGlrZWx5IGJlbG93IDI4 Cj4gKyAgICAgICAgcmV0dXJuOwo+ICsgICAgfQo+ICsKPiArICAgIGlmICgobiA9IGZmX0FNZWRp YUNvZGVjX2NvbG9yX2Zvcm1hdHNfaW50ZXJzZWN0KG5hbWUsIG1pbWUsIGluX2Zvcm1hdHMsCj4g KyA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ICBGRl9B UlJBWV9FTEVNUyhpbl9mb3JtYXRzKSwKPiArICAgICAgICAgICAgICAgICAgICAgICAgICAgICAg ICAgICAgICAgICAgICAgICAgICAgIG91dF9mb3JtYXRzLCBhdmN0eCkpIDwgMCkgewo+ICsgICAg ICAgIGdvdG8gZG9uZTsKPiArICAgIH0KPiArCj4gKyAgICBmb3IgKGludCBpID0gMDsgaSA8IG47 IGkrKykgewo+ICsgICAgICAgIGlmIChjb2xvcjJwaXhfZm10KGF2Y3R4LCBvdXRfZm9ybWF0c1tp XSkgPT0gYXZjdHgtPnBpeF9mbXQpIHsKPiArICAgICAgICAgICAgLy8gdXNlciBzcGVjaWZpZWQg YSBwaXhlbCBmb3JtYXQgdGhhdCBpcyBhY3R1YWxseSBzdXBwb3J0ZWQsCj4gKyAgICAgICAgICAg IC8vIG5vIG5lZWQgdG8gcHJpbnQgYW55dGhpbmcKPiArICAgICAgICAgICAgZ290byBkb25lOwo+ ICsgICAgICAgIH0KPiArICAgIH0KPiArCj4gKyAgICBBVlBpeEZtdERlc2NyaXB0b3IgKmRlc2Mg PSBhdl9waXhfZm10X2Rlc2NfZ2V0KGF2Y3R4LT5waXhfZm10KTsKCk1pc3Npbmcg4oCYY29uc3Ti gJkgYW5kIHRyaWdnZXJlZCAtV2RlY2xhcmF0aW9uLWFmdGVyLXN0YXRlbWVudC4KCj4gKyAgICBh dl9sb2coYXZjdHgsIEFWX0xPR19FUlJPUiwgInBpeGVsIGZvcm1hdCAlcyBub3Qgc3VwcG9ydGVk IGJ5IE1lZGlhQ29kZWMgJXNcbiIsIGRlc2MtPm5hbWUsIG5hbWUpOwo+ICsgICAgYXZfbG9nKGF2 Y3R4LCBBVl9MT0dfSU5GTywgInN1cHBvcnRlZCBmb3JtYXRzIGFyZToiKTsKPiArICAgIGZvciAo aW50IGkgPSAwOyBpIDwgbjsgaSsrKSB7Cj4gKyAgICAgICAgZGVzYyA9IGF2X3BpeF9mbXRfZGVz Y19nZXQoY29sb3IycGl4X2ZtdChhdmN0eCwgb3V0X2Zvcm1hdHNbaV0pKTsKPiArICAgICAgICBh dl9sb2coYXZjdHgsIEFWX0xPR19JTkZPLCAiICVzIiwgZGVzYy0+bmFtZSk7Cj4gKyAgICB9Cj4g KyAgICBhdl9sb2coYXZjdHgsIEFWX0xPR19JTkZPLCAiXG4iKTsKCkl04oCZcyBub3QgdGhyZWFk IHNhZmUsIGl0IGNhbiBiZSBpbnRlcnJ1cHRlZCBieSBvdGhlciB0aHJlYWRzJyBsb2cgbWVzc2Fn ZS4KCj4gKwo+ICtkb25lOgo+ICsgICAgYXZfZnJlZShuYW1lKTsKPiArfQo+ICsKPiAgc3RhdGlj IGludCBtZWRpYWNvZGVjX2luaXRfYnNmKEFWQ29kZWNDb250ZXh0ICphdmN0eCkKPiAgewo+ICAg ICAgTWVkaWFDb2RlY0VuY0NvbnRleHQgKnMgPSBhdmN0eC0+cHJpdl9kYXRhOwo+IEBAIC0zMDgs NiArMzUzLDcgQEAgc3RhdGljIGF2X2NvbGQgaW50IG1lZGlhY29kZWNfaW5pdChBVkNvZGVjQ29u dGV4dCAqYXZjdHgpCj4gICAgICByZXQgPSBmZl9BTWVkaWFDb2RlY19jb25maWd1cmUocy0+Y29k ZWMsIGZvcm1hdCwgcy0+d2luZG93LCBOVUxMLCByZXQpOwo+ICAgICAgaWYgKHJldCkgewo+ICAg ICAgICAgIGF2X2xvZyhhdmN0eCwgQVZfTE9HX0VSUk9SLCAiTWVkaWFDb2RlYyBjb25maWd1cmUg ZmFpbGVkLCAlc1xuIiwgYXZfZXJyMnN0cihyZXQpKTsKPiArICAgICAgICBsaXN0X3BpeF9mbXRz KGF2Y3R4LCBjb2RlY19taW1lKTsKPiAgICAgICAgICBnb3RvIGJhaWxvdXQ7Cj4gICAgICB9Cj4g IAo+IC0tIAo+IDIuMzAuMgo+IApf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fXwpmZm1wZWctZGV2ZWwgbWFpbGluZyBsaXN0CmZmbXBlZy1kZXZlbEBmZm1wZWcu b3JnCmh0dHBzOi8vZmZtcGVnL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2ZmbXBlZy1kZXZlbAoKVG8g dW5zdWJzY3JpYmUsIHZpc2l0IGxpbmsgYWJvdmUsIG9yIGVtYWlsCmZmbXBlZy1kZXZlbC1yZXF1 ZXN0QGZmbXBlZy5vcmcgd2l0aCBzdWJqZWN0ICJ1bnN1YnNjcmliZSIuCg==